Best Melatonin Alternatives UK: What You Can Buy Without a Prescription

By Zynaero Team  ·  June 2026  ·  5 min read

Why You Need a Melatonin Alternative in the UK

Unlike in the United States, Canada, or many EU countries, melatonin in the UK is classified as a Prescription-Only Medicine (POM) by the MHRA. This means you cannot walk into a pharmacy or health food shop and buy melatonin off the shelf — you need a doctor's prescription.

For many people — those who don't qualify for a prescription, who don't want to go through the GP process for a sleep supplement, or who simply prefer a natural approach — this creates a clear need: what can I take instead?

The good news is that several melatonin alternatives are not only legal in the UK without prescription, they may actually be more effective for the type of insomnia most people experience.

Understanding Why You Can't Sleep First

Before reaching for any supplement, it's worth understanding what's actually causing your sleep problem. Melatonin is specifically effective for circadian disruption — jet lag, shift work, delayed sleep phase. If your problem is anxiety, racing thoughts, stress, or muscle tension keeping you awake, melatonin does relatively little. Most UK insomnia falls into this second category.

The melatonin alternatives below are often better suited to general insomnia precisely because they target these actual causes.

The Best Melatonin Alternatives Available in the UK

1. Valerian Root — Best for Falling Asleep

What it does: Increases GABA (gamma-aminobutyric acid) — the brain's primary calming neurotransmitter. Reduces time to fall asleep by 15–30 minutes with consistent use. Over 70 clinical trials support its use for insomnia.

UK legal status: Available without prescription as a herbal supplement. Sold in Holland & Barrett, Boots, independent health food shops, and online.

Recommended dose: 300–600mg of standardised extract per night, taken 30–60 minutes before bed.

How long until it works: 1–2 weeks of daily use for full effect. Some people notice calming effects sooner.

Best for: People who take a long time to fall asleep, fragmented sleep, mild insomnia.

2. L-Theanine — Best for Racing Thoughts

What it does: An amino acid from green tea that promotes calm alertness by increasing alpha brain waves and reducing cortisol. Does not cause drowsiness — instead, it creates the neurological conditions for sleep.

UK legal status: Available as a supplement without prescription. Widely available online and in health food shops.

Recommended dose: 100–200mg per night, 30–60 minutes before bed.

How long until it works: 20–30 minutes for initial effect. Builds with consistent use.

Best for: Anxiety-driven insomnia, racing thoughts, overactive mind at bedtime.

3. Magnesium Glycinate — Best for Restless Sleep

What it does: An estimated 30% of UK adults are magnesium deficient. Deficiency directly causes poor sleep quality, muscle tension, and nighttime restlessness. Magnesium glycinate is the most absorbable form — 40–60% versus 4% for the cheap magnesium oxide in some products.

UK legal status: Available as a supplement without prescription. Available everywhere from supermarkets to specialist online retailers.

Recommended dose: 300–400mg of elemental magnesium as glycinate, taken before bed.

How long until it works: Some relaxation within days; fuller sleep improvement in 1–4 weeks.

Best for: Restlessness, muscle tension, waking in the night, leg cramps, jaw clenching.

4. Passionflower — Best for Stress and Anxiety

What it does: A traditional European herbal remedy that specifically targets anxiety-driven insomnia by increasing GABA and reducing cortisol. Particularly effective for people who lie awake worrying or feel 'wired but tired.'

UK legal status: Available as a herbal supplement without prescription. Found in health food shops and online.

Recommended dose: 300–400mg of standardised extract per night.

How long until it works: 1–2 weeks of daily use.

Best for: Anxiety-driven insomnia, nighttime worry, stress-related wakefulness.

5. 5-HTP — The Closest to Melatonin

What it does: 5-HTP is converted in the body to serotonin, which then converts to melatonin. It supports the natural melatonin production pathway rather than supplementing the hormone directly. Also supports mood, making it particularly useful when low mood contributes to poor sleep.

UK legal status: Available as a supplement without prescription. Note: should not be combined with prescription antidepressants (SSRIs or SNRIs) without medical advice.

Recommended dose: 50–100mg per night, 30 minutes before bed.

How long until it works: 2–4 weeks for full effect.

Best for: Mood-linked insomnia, anxiety and sleep together, supporting natural melatonin production.

OTC Sleep Aids Available in UK Pharmacies

UK pharmacies also stock several over-the-counter sleep aids worth knowing about:

  • Nytol One-a-Night (diphenhydramine): An antihistamine-based sedative for short-term use. Effective but causes tolerance rapidly — not recommended for regular use.
  • Nytol Herbal: Contains hops, valerian root, and passionflower. One of the most accessible multi-ingredient herbal options in UK pharmacies.
  • Kalms Night: Valerian root tablets available in most UK pharmacies and supermarkets.
